Spinal Glia Division Contributes to Conditioning Lesion–Induced Axon Regeneration Into the Injured Spinal Cord: Potential Role of Cyclic AMP–Induced Tissue Inhibitor of Metalloproteinase-1
Regeneration of sensory neurons after spinal cord injury depends on the function of dividing neuronal-glial antigen 2 (NG2)–expressing cells.
